Why Marvel Won't Give Hawkeye A Movie - Duration: 5:47.

Hawkeye started out as a supervillain back in 1964, but soon switched sides and teamed

up with the Avengers in 1965 — and he's been a key player in the Marvel universe ever

since.

From his cameo appearance in 2011's Thor, to his expanded roles in the Avengers movies

and Captain America: Civil War, Hawkeye is a fixture of the Marvel Cinematic Universe

these days.

The studio was wise enough to lock up-and-comer Jeremy Renner into a longterm contract early

on, and he's become a star in his own right over the past few years.

So why won't Marvel give Hawkeye a movie?

Fatigue

Renner has been a cog in the Marvel machine for a while now, but he was famously unhappy

with his role in The Avengers.

The actor made it clear he felt his character was short-changed, and considering he spent

most of the movie mindlessly brainwashed and working for Loki, it's hard to argue.

He told Hero Complex:

"At the end of the day, 90 percent of the movie, I'm not the character I signed on

to play.

I'm literally in there for two minutes, and then all of a sudden…"

Thankfully, he's warmed up to his superhero role since then.

During a Reddit AMA while promoting Avengers: Age of Ultron, he said he would "be game"

if Marvel ever wanted to make a superhero movie.

But, he'll be six movies in after the next two Avengers films.

He may be game for now, but it's hard not to wonder how long he'll be interested in

playing Marvel's man who can't miss.

"I've done the whole mind control thing...not a fan."

But let's assume Marvel starts to look at Hawkeye's comic book history for inspiration.

Well, they may not find much…

Short on stories

Hawkeye has been around the comic scene for decades, but he doesn't really have a lot

of iconic stories that would translate well to the big screen.

There's a reason fans have been begging for a Black Widow movie — the super spy

has a mysterious backstory well worth exploring.

The same goes for fellow heroes like The Winter Soldier, Hulk, and Black Panther.

But Age of Ultron already filled in a lot of the gaps in Hawkeye's story.

When he's not off being a hero, he lives a quiet life married to Linda Cardellini and

playing with his adorable kids.

Hawkeye is just a regular guy in the MCU.

While that's part of his appeal, it's hard to make a $100 million dollar blockbuster

about an average guy.

Speaking of which…

The Fraction Factor

Writer Matt Fraction's 2012 Hawkeye series was one of the most acclaimed comics Marvel

has published in years.

But that doesn't mean it'd be a good fit on the big screen.

The comic was a hit because it pretty much ignored the fact that Hawkeye is a superhero,

and instead focused on his regular life in a New York City apartment building.

Hawkeye hung around with Kate Bishop, a younger hero who also goes by the name Hawkeye, and

faced off with a group of Russian gangsters.

It was almost the Seinfeld of comic books.

"Well after ordering, Mr. Seinfeld and Mr. Costanza debated on whether or not Iron Man

wore some sort of undergarment between his skin and his iron suit."

"Uh huh."

"And I still say he's naked under there!"

"Oh that makes a lot of sense."

"Ah shut up!"

The series was arguably Hawkeye's best outing in comic books, so fans might think it'd be

the right inspiration for a movie.

It even won a ton of awards, and was a crazy fun story — but it didn't exactly have

the makings of a Hollywood blockbuster.

Though, it would make one heck of a good Netflix TV series.

Just sayin'.

Packed schedule

You'll hear this one pretty much anytime you talk about Marvel movies.

They make a lot of them, and there are plenty more on the way.

The studio has released more than a dozen films, with around half a dozen more already

in development.

You already have Guardians of the Galaxy Volume 2, Thor: Ragnarok, Black Panther, Captain

Marvel and the next two Avengers films on the way.

And that's just naming a few.

Put simply, there are lots of options on the table, and Hawkeye has already been in his

fair share of movies.

Low-power, high stakes

No offense to all the archer heroes in the Marvel and DC universes, but Hawkeye is basically

a guy fighting aliens and giant robots with a stick and a string.

Hawkeye said it himself.

"Ok look, the city is flying, we're fighting an army of robots...and I have a bow and arrow.

None of this makes sense."

But Iron Man does make sense because he has cool, high-tech armor.

Thor makes sense because he flies around the universe bashing bad guys with a magic hammer.

But shooting arrows?

It's cool, sure, but it's not on the same level.

"Keep up old man!"

"Nobody would know...nobody."

There's a reason DC decided to turn Green Arrow into a TV series.

It seems that skill set is just better suited for adventures on the small screen.

Team-up

Clint Barton was the heart and soul of the Avengers in Age of Ultron, and that's because

he just works really well on a team.

Most of his best moments in the MCU are when he's teamed up with other heroes, and he's

a character who works best when he has someone to play off of.

He's had a lot of interesting story arcs in the comics over the years, but most of

them are tied to larger Avengers stories.

He's died.

He's come back to life.

He's even hung up his bow and arrow to be a ninja for a while — like you do.

But, all of those stories were connected to the Avengers.

Age of Ultron was pretty much Hawkeye at his best, and that's because it gave fans just

enough to leave them wanting more, as opposed to two full hours of pure, unfiltered Hawkeye.

So what about Kate?

Marvel doesn't seem to be afraid of trying out new characters, so why not give the other

arrow-person a shot?

If Marvel really wanted to get creative, it could bench Barton and introduce that other

Hawkeye: Kate Bishop.

Kate was introduced in 2005 in Marvel Comics' Young Avengers comics series, and took up

the name Hawkeye in 2006.

Over the past decade, she's become a close friend to Barton, and is arguably the better

archer.

Nowadays in the comics, she's kicking around California to work as a hard-boiled private

eye.

So maybe she should get a movie, right?

But there's a problem.

Outside of comic readers, she isn't a very well-known character at all.

Considering we're still waiting on Miles Morales Spider-Man to get his own live-action movie,

Kate seems like a long shot too.

The Untold Truth Of Florence Henderson - Duration: 6:19.

Florence Henderson raised a lot of children — and not just the six kiddos from The Brady

Bunch.

Because of her long-lived cultural impact on the TV-watching world and her influence

on many viewers' upbringings, she's been nicknamed "America's Mom."

Her late 2016 passing at the age of 82 hit fans particularly hard in a year filled with

so many celebrity deaths.

The sitcom star was beloved for her tempered management of such a large brood on-screen

and her fun-loving attitude when the camera's weren't rolling.

Even though many television viewers might feel like they know Florence Henderson as

their shared fictional mother, there are still a few details about her life that might surprise

audiences.

Here's the untold truth of Florence Henderson.

Reality bites

There's a reason Henderson's on-screen affections for her Brady brigade read as genuine.

She was trying to make up for the motherly love that she never had in her own life.

The actress revealed that, as the 10th child to her impoverished parents, she wasn't given

much affection as a kid.

In response, she portrayed Carol Brady as the kind of mom she always wished she had

and was glad to have the chance to share the love with so many on-screen and off.

Breaking molds

Just before she became a legend of the sitcom scene, Henderson also made history by becoming

the first female guest host for The Tonight Show in 1962.

She was hired to fill in on the show and later earned the title "Today Girl" on The Today

Show.

Her stint on the program wasn't as well remembered as her turn as Carol Brady, of course, but

it was certainly an auspicious start to what would become a flourishing career in television.

Mom squad goals

Shirley Jones, who played the similarly beloved on-screen mom on The Partridge Family, might've

been on a competing show.

But the two were really close friends in real-life, going back to their earliest days on the stage.

The pair met early on in their careers when they were starring together in a stage performance

of Oklahoma! and became lifelong gal pals.

Interestingly enough, Jones revealed in her 2013 memoir that she had originally received

an offer to star as Carol Brady in the series, but that she turned it down because she didn't

"want to be the mother taking the roast out of the oven and not doing much else."

If that seems harsh, well, yeah, it kinda was, but these two have always had a tongue-in-cheek

relationship with one another where the public is concerned.

Henderson once said she'd gone out for the Broadway revival of Oklahoma! but "that b****

Shirley Jones got it!"

Jones snapped back by joking, "Either she was smiling when she said it…

Or she wasn't smiling when she said it, in which case the new Florence Henderson is about

to see how it feels to get her block knocked off by an old and well-trained Danny Bonaduce's

mama."

Something tells us she might've had her work cut out for her in that bout.

"There's only one thing left to do…"

"What?"

"Really get in there and fight."

Double mom duty

According to many of her pretend kids on The Brady Bunch, Henderson was just as nurturing

a mother behind the scenes as she was when the cameras were rolling.

In fact, actress Susan Olsen, who played the youngest girl, Cindy Brady, said that Henderson

once saved her life during a production accident while they were filming in Hawaii and she

fell off of a ledge.

Olsen said she considered Henderson to be a mother figure to her, and even her children

considered Henderson their second grandmother.

She also credited Henderson with balancing her two motherly universes so well, adding

that she often spent time with Henderson's real children so that she could make time

for everyone.

Sick smooch

Actor Barry Williams, who portrayed Henderson's on-screen stepson Greg Brady, claimed to have

once dated Henderson in his autobiography.

Henderson herself clarified on her website that the story was "blown way out of proportion"

and that it was only a date "because Barry thought it was."

Meanwhile, Williams nevertheless revisited the story after her passing to again tell

the tale of that time he once planted a smooch on his TV mom, saying that he invited her

out to talk shop as an "excuse to pick her up in the car and take her out and try to

steal a kiss."

Getting very sleepy

Although Henderson had plenty of work to do on-screen and raising her real-life quartet

of kids, she still pursued a second career passion — as a licensed hypnotherapist!

She first got into the practice to deal with her own fear of flying and stage fright, and

she used the trade to help others around her deal with their issues.

She was once even asked by Christopher Knight, who'd played Peter Brady on the show, to appear

on his show My Fair Brady and perform some of her counseling with then-girlfriend Adrianne

Curry.

Parting gifts

Henderson might have maintained a wholesome public image over the years, but she's had

her fair share of naughty moments over the years as well.

Henderson revealed in her 2011 biography that she had a one night stand with former New

York City mayor John Lindsay, which took place while she was still married to her first husband

Ira Bernstein.

Her comeuppance for that bad behavior came quickly, as she contracted a case of crabs

from the politician.

Henderson didn't shy away from the creepy-crawly subject, however, writing:

"Guess I learned the hard way that crabs do not discriminate, but cross over all socioeconomic

strata.

He must have had quite the active life.

What a way to put the kibosh on a relationship."

Senior vitality

Even as an octogenarian, Henderson refused to stop living life.

"Which booking is this?

Are you the pervert who wanted to go to town on each other while I make a pie?"

Not only did she stay active with her extracurricular activities and become the oldest-ever Dancing

With the Stars contestant, but she was a vocal proponent of staying young on the inside and

outside later in life.

"Things don't stop working in your body or your mind and it's so important to keep moving."

She even boasted about being "friends with benefits" with a gentleman caller and said

that it's "foolish" of society to think that senior citizens don't enjoy the horizontal

mambo as much as everyone else.

That might sound dirty, but Carol Brady would definitely approve of her mantra.

"The magic of youth… too bad we grow up and lose it."

"Who said we have to lose it?"

The Real Reason Why Women Are Always Colder Than Men - Duration: 4:34.

One conflict that will probably never end is the battle of the thermostat in a space

shared by men and women.

Men are always turning it down, and women are two steps behind them, turning it right

back up again.

Despite theories to the contrary, women are not just being weak or wasteful — there

are scientific reasons why they often find themselves feeling much chillier than the

men in the same room.

Here's the real reason why women are always colder than men.

"Can I turn the heat up?"

"Oh, don't touch the thermostat Meg, your father gets upset."

"Come on, this thing goes up to 90!"

"Who touched the thermostat?"

Colder extremities

Women's icy-cold hands and feet are a long-running joke between married couples at bedtime.

But there's science to back up the phenomenon.

In 1998, researchers at the University of Utah found that though women's core body temperatures

were higher on average, their hands were consistently colder.

And it wasn't a subtle change — the study found women's hands to be about three degrees

cooler than men's.

The reason?

Women's bodies are better at pulling heat back to their organs to conserve it during

cold conditions.

When that happens, though, their hands and feet pay the price for keeping essential organs

at a warmer running temp.

This explains why, when walking through a cool office, you'll see many more women than

men rubbing their hands together to get warm.

Metabolism

Men naturally have higher metabolic rates than women — a fact that has been annoying

women for ages.

According to a study in the Journal of Applied Psychology, the metabolism of most men runs

at about 23 percent higher than women's.

This not only means men have an easier time burning fat, it also means they have warmer

bodies.

Metabolism is the way our bodies burn calories for fuel, and in the process, heats our bodies.

Since women's bodies are burning less fuel, it makes sense that they'd be the chillier

of the species.

Fat to muscle ratio

The way our bodies are composed also has a lot to do with how warm we feel.

In general, men have more muscle and less fat than women.

Since muscle is better at generating heat, this gives men an advantage when it comes

to keeping warm in cool temps.

An article in Popular Science found that while fat does conserve heat, it traps it at the

core, below the skin.

Wait, what?

What this means is that the minute your skin cools down, you'll cool down — even if

your core is still warm.

Add it to the long list of reasons to get your butt in the gym and pump some iron.

Smaller size

Body size also has a lot to do with how cold a person feels.

On average, men are larger than women, both in height and weight.

Brad Fiero, Faculty member at Pima Community College has an entire lesson plan explaining

how size matters in regulating body temperature.

According to his lesson, since women tend to be smaller, they usually have a larger

surface area to volume ratio.

This means that more heat is lost at a faster speed through their larger surface area.

In relation, that smaller volume means less retained heat.

Menstruation

Women's body temperatures tend to fluctuate throughout their menstrual cycles due to rising

and falling hormone levels.

This means depending on what time of the month it is, they may be even more affected by cool

temperatures than normal.

The situation is exacerbated even more when women take birth control.

One 2001 study published in PubMed.gov found that women who took oral contraceptives had

raised body temperatures during some parts of their cycles, making for an intense and

chilly dip when it went back down.

Different perceptions

Another explanation for women being colder than men is that women feel the cold differently

than men do.

According to professors David W. Niesel and Norbert K. Herzog of Medical Discovery News:

"When women feel cold, they constrict blood vessels near the skin surface to retain core

body heat, but it makes them feel colder."

Basically, our bodies have a totally different physical reaction to the very same temperatures.

Weird.

Because men and women typically react exactly the same in most situations.

Just kidding.

Office temps and attire

Women who spend their days in office buildings tend to find themselves in a rough spot when

it comes to dressing for the weather.

A 2015 study published in Nature Climate Change finally proved what women have known all along

— office temperatures are designed for the comfort of a man.

The study found that most office buildings set their thermostats according to outdated

formulas based on the metabolic rates of men.

This might have made sense decades ago, when most offices were predominantly male, but

it's much less acceptable today, when the number of women equal, if not surpass, the

number of men.

The study also revealed that the longstanding "thermal comfort model" employed by offices

everywhere takes into consideration another factor: clothing insulation levels.

Men wear suits, and suits can make them hot.

Pair the chilly office temps with women's regular office attire of dresses, skirts,

and thin blouses, and you'll begin to understand what all the shivering is about — and why

so many women have heaters under their desks, gloves and scarves stashed in their drawers,

and a heavy cardigan thrown over their chairs.

And this isn't just true in the winter.

In the summer months, the air conditioning usually gets cranked up to near-freezing levels,

blowing theories of energy conservation right out the window.

Suddenly, wearing a suit jacket every day doesn't sound like such a bad idea, does it?

This War of Mine: The Little Ones - Diary: Our future - Trophy/Achievement (CZ) - Duration: 1:43.

Your task to get this reward is

you must have a child survive and reach the ceasefire.

Here is the recommended setting custom Game.

There are some important things to know about children in the game that differ from adults.

Children cannot stand guard, go out on scavenging trips, or trade with Franko during the day.

The only option they have at night time is to sleep.

Resting will not help children recover from wounds or sickness.

You will need to use Bandages to heal wounds and Meds to heal sickness.

Furthermore, these must be administered by an adult.

Children cannot build items outside of those they can be taught.

Once you get to the end of the game with a child and survive. Unlock rewards.
